Blimey. An American A&R man's wet dream. Three mouth-watering The Corrs sisters
(Sharon, Caroline, Andrea) and their brother (Jim) who can harmonise, play instruments and
write radio-friendly songs with just enough blarney to sucker the ex-patriate
transatlantic Irish, just enough new country to turn heads in Nashville, just enough AOR
to guarantee saturation radio play, and sultry looks that MTV would kill for. Naturally,
it's impeccably played, performed and recorded but too often the finished product comes
uncomfortably close to a cross between The Bangles and The Nolans. That may be enough to
shift multi-platinum quantities in America from now until doomsday but it's unlikely to
stand up to repeated plays if you like a bit of meat on your bone.
